I wonder if you can help me with this problem.
I have a Nestable Manual Nav block (Pixel Top Bar template) in the Sitewide Global Top Left Area and a Switch Language block (Pixel Top Bar template) in the Sitewide Global Top Right Area. When viewed on a mobile device I would like the Nestable Manual Nav to be pulled to the left and the Switch Language block to be on the same line, pulled to the right, and with the language menu opening to the left instead of right.
I attached 2 screenshots (portrait and landscape).

I figured it out on my own :)
I added these lines in custom.dev.less
#top-bar .col_half { width: auto!important; } .top-links, .top-links > ul > li { float: left!important; } #top-bar > div > div.col_half.fright.col_last.nobottommargin > div > ul > li > ul { left: auto !important; right: 0 !important;}
I don't know if this is the best solution but is working so far.
